>> You could always add
>> deb http://ftp.iinet.net.au/debian/debian-amd64/ sarge main contrib
>> non-free and you'll failover to that one if you put it in second place if
>> there's something wrong with the first. On that point, you may want to put
>> the main US servers on third position and if all else fails get it from
>> there.
